The first comment miss the fact that it is odd game
1. f4?? { (0.15 → -5.42) Blunder. e4 was best. } (1. e4 c5 2. Nf3 d6 3. d4 cxd4 4. Nxd4 Nc6 5. Nc3 g6)
The second comment suggest a move that is not the best move assuming in losing positions the best move is the move that delay the mate as far as possible.
{ (-75.29 → Mate in 13) Checkmate is now unavoidable. Ke5 was best. } (45. Ke5 g1=Q 46. Kf4 Qd4+ 47. Kf5 Qxc4 48. a3 Qd5+ 49. Kf6 Kc7 50. a4 Kd7)
Facts are that 45.Kc5 is best because other moves lose faster based on chest that searched for the fastest mate.
I do not think it is important to make comments about change in evaluation from -75.29 to some forced mate when both are practically 100% loss but if you make these comments then at least you should verify that the alternative move is better in the meaning that the opponent needs more moves to force checkmate after it.

There seems to be a bug in Stockfish.
1. f4?? (0.15 → -5.42)
It assumes that whites starting position is 0.15, while it is something like -5 because of the rook missing. Maybe Stockfish should do a static analysis of the starting position before starting the search.
